Porter Regional Hospital’s Center for Cardiovascular Medicine Hosts Free Community Open House

Center-for-Cardiovascular-MedicinePorter Regional Hospital is inviting the community to get a firsthand look inside its new Center for Cardiovascular Medicine during a free community open house from 9 a.m. to Noon on Saturday, Nov. 3. The Center for Cardiovascular Medicine is located on the west side of Porter Regional Hospital, with its own private entrance and parking.

The free open house will offer community members the opportunity to tour the innovative Center, see the new Cardiac Cath and Electrophysiology Labs, view the advanced cardiac diagnostic and imaging technology, and meet the Center’s skilled physicians and staff. Additionally, guests will be able to enjoy a heart healthy continental breakfast and receive free health screenings.

Referred to as a ‘heart hospital within a hospital,’ the Center for Cardiovascular Medicine houses all of Porter’s cardiovascular services in one convenient location. Built with efficiency and an improved patient experience in mind, the Center was designed to provide comprehensive evaluation, consultation, and medical and surgical management of diseases of the heart and circulatory system for the region’s growing population.

The award-winning Center has received the Get With The Guidelines Heart Failure Silver Award from the American Heart Association, Chest Pain Center Accreditation from the Society of Cardiovascular Patient Care, Blue Distinction designation for Cardiac Care from Blue Cross Blue Shield and is a Certified Stroke Center by The Joint Commission. Additionally the Center houses the Center for Heart Valve Disease.

Supported with the latest in cardiac diagnostic and imaging technology, the Center boasts experienced members of the medical staff including cardiologists, cardiovascular surgeons and interventional radiologists.

Porter Health Care System has two hospital campuses and seven outpatient facilities serving Porter, Lake, LaPorte, Starke and Jasper counties. With more than 350 physicians representing 50 medical specialties on the medical staff, Porter Health Care System is a leader in technology and quality patient care.
